A prominent UK food company based in Norwich is seeking a Graduate Supplier & Raw Materials Technologist. This role involves engaging with suppliers to ensure high standards of food safety and quality.

  • Supporting audits
  • Maintaining supplier relationships
  • Participating in sustainability initiatives

Ideal candidates will possess a relevant degree and demonstrate strong communication and problem-solving skills. This position offers hybrid working as well as a structured development path with real responsibility from day one.

How to prepare for a job interview at Valeo Foods UK

✨Know Your Stuff

Make sure you brush up on food safety standards and quality assurance processes. Familiarise yourself with the company's sustainability initiatives and be ready to discuss how you can contribute to these efforts.

✨Show Off Your Communication Skills

Since this role involves engaging with suppliers, practice articulating your thoughts clearly. Prepare examples of how you've effectively communicated in past experiences, especially in problem-solving scenarios.

✨Be Ready for Scenario Questions

Expect questions that assess your ability to handle real-life situations. Think about times when you've had to maintain relationships or resolve conflicts, and be prepared to share those stories.

✨Ask Thoughtful Questions

At the end of the interview, have a few insightful questions ready. This shows your genuine interest in the role and the company. You might ask about their approach to supplier audits or how they measure success in sustainability initiatives.
